Abstract

The invention relates to the field of vegetable planting and discloses a device for producing sprouts by using the water from an air conditioner, which is characterized by comprising a planting tank which is used for providing a space for the growth of the sprouts, a planting plate which is positioned at the bottom in the planting tank and is used for planting the sprouts and an automatic water supply device which is positioned at the top in the planting tank and is used for collecting condensate water from the air conditioner and transmitting the condensate water into the planting plate in the planting tank. In the invention, according to the characteristics that the light requirement property of sprout production is not strong (various sprouts need to grow under the condition without light), and the sprouts are needed to be watered each 8-10h, a tank device which utilizes the condensate water from the air conditioner for sprout production is designed, the tank device is placed in a shade place after being communicated with a water tube, then the condensate water is utilized for cultivating the sprouts, and the entire device is convenient and compact. According to the invention, not only can the condensate water from the air conditioner is effectively utilized for producing the sprouts, but also water resources can be saved, and meanwhile, environmental-friendly and healthy sprouts are produced.

Embodiment
Below in conjunction with accompanying drawing and embodiment, specific embodiments of the invention describes in further detail.Following examples are used to explain the present invention, but are not used for limiting scope of the present invention.
As shown in Figure 8, be the interior sketch map of the planting box of the production bud seeding kind device of present embodiment, it comprises: planting box 3 is used to the bud seeding kind growth space is provided; Planting plate 2 is positioned at the bottom of planting box 3, is used to the bud seeding kind of planting; Automatic water feeder 1 is positioned at the top of planting box 3; Automatic water feeder 1 is used to collect the condensed water that air-conditioning produces, and condensed water is transported on the planting plate 2 in the planting box 3.The characteristics that the present invention produces light requirement property strong (multiple bud seeding kind need not have under the optical condition cultivate), whenever need water once at a distance from 8~10 hours according to bud seeding kind; Design a kind of air conditioner condensate water that can make full use of and carry out the box body device that bud seeding kind is produced; Itself and air-conditioning outlet pipe are connected and are placed on shady and cool place; Be that condensed water capable of using is cultivated bud seeding kind; Integral body is accomplished convenience, succinct, and the water source has been practiced thrift in the production that both can effectively utilize air conditioner condensate water to carry out bud seeding kind, has also produced the bud seeding kind of green health simultaneously.
In conjunction with shown in Fig. 1 to 5, automatic water feeder 1 is a body structure in the present embodiment, and the bottom of casing has delivery port; The delivery port place is provided with the bottom plug 11 of downward unlatching, and bottom plug 11 is connected with bent axle 12 through a fulcrum 14 of the bottom half of automatic water feeder 1, and the other end of bent axle 12 is fixed with briquetting 13; The top of automatic water feeder 1 has water inlet 15 and ventilation hole 22.The delivery port bottom is sealed by bottom plug 11, and bottom plug 11 is connected with a briquetting 13 through box house one bent axle 12.11 big light weights of bottom plug, the little matter of 13 of briquettings are heavy, so bottom plug is used the mouth of a river and is in closed condition under the previous status.The drainpipe of air conditioner condensate water is communicated to the water inlet of automatic water feeder 1 top.Wait to catchment after a certain amount of; Because bottom plug receives the pressure and the briquetting 13 of the condensed water of continuous rising and receives under the buoyancy; Upwards go up perks based on fulcrum 14 briquettings 13, bottom plug 11 is to lower swing and then open the delivery port of bottom half, and the condensed water that collection is good just flow on the planting plate 2 of below.After the condensed water emptying, bottom plug 11 is sealed delivery port again under the effect of the gravity of briquetting 13.The collecting amount of condensed water can be regulated according to the water requirement or the need water time interval of bud seeding kind; Concrete be provided with can through as the relation of height selecting to catchment in briquetting 13 weight, volume and the automatic water feeder 1 design, can also regulate like the position on briquetting 13 bent axles 12 arm of force of fulcrum 14 (promptly with respect to) and wait a confluent of regulating automatic water feeder 1.Generally bud seeding kind needs to replenish in 8~10 hours a moisture, and the design of automatic water feeder 1 casing can be according to greater than above-mentioned water yield setting.
As shown in Figure 6, lobed edge 21, the relative both sides of planting plate 2 in the present embodiment leaves slit 23 (representing like dotted line in the accompanying drawing) between the side side plate of edge 21 and planting box 3, and the other both sides of planting plate 2 closely are connected with the side side plate of planting box 3; Be evenly distributed with a plurality of osculums 22 on the planting plate 2, be equipped with water-storage material (not shown in the accompanying drawing) on the planting plate, the height of water-storage material is lower than the edge.Planting plate 2 is a porous plate; The preferred planting plate of present embodiment position plastic plate; Its tool edge, both sides 21; But leave small gaps 23 between the side side plate of edge 21 and planting box 3 casings, both sides closely are connected with the side side plate of planting box 3 casings in addition, and water flows to planting plate 2 above just 23 outflows from the slit behind the height at edge like this.The height at edge 21 can be confirmed according to the water requirement of plantation bud seeding kind.The osculum 22 that tool is small on the planting plate; Height is a little less than the edge behind one deck water-storage material of upper berth; Water-storage material gets final product retaining like this, and excessive moisture can be discharged through osculum 22 again, and this design can prevent that bud seeding kind from taking root and stop up osculum 22 and cause impeded drainage.The preferred nonwoven of water-storage material in the present embodiment, nonwoven not only can have been realized the maintenance of moisture but also can prevent that the bud seeding kind root from stopping up osculum 22.Water-storage material also can select to have like silk, silk floss, chemical fibre etc. the material of certain retaining property accordingly.In the bud seeding kind production process, after taking root, bud seeding kind takes root in water-storage material.
The number of present embodiment planting plate 2 is a plurality of, and promptly planting plate 2 can be provided with multilayer according to casing 3 sizes.Planting plate 2 is stacked placement in planting box 3.So just can produce more bud seeding kind by limited casing, make its production more efficient.
Be the setting of the planting plate 2 of the bud seeding kind that cooperates multilayer, the preferred planting box 3 of present embodiment is up big and down small trapezoidal cabinet.If design multilayer planting plate 2, planting box 3 is designed to up big and down small trapezium structure, is convenient to water and flows in lower floor's planting plate 2 after through upper strata planting plate 2, when idle, can be nested in together simultaneously, saves the occupation of land space widely.
As shown in Figure 7, planting box 3 is the casing with case lid in the present embodiment; The side of planting box 3 is provided with the venetian blind type ventilating opening.Casing is a plastic box with cover, and automatic water feeder 1 is positioned at its inner top, so the top of planting box is automatic water feeder 1 water inlet and air vent is set, and is convenient to the air-conditioning drainpipe and inserts.There is venetian blind type ventilating opening 32 the casing both sides of planting box 3, are convenient to circulation of air and supply with the bud seeding kind required oxygen of growing.The bottom of planting box is provided with wheel 31, and its top is provided with handle 33, convenient moving.
